General Description

The Real Estate Division is seeking candidates to fill a Property Agent vacancy. This skilled work includes processing routine temporary revocable easements, rights of entry and real estate service requests in addition to preparing basic legal forms and transactional documents. Performing basic components of professional level acquisition, disposition and property management are also essential functions of a Property Agent. The position is customer service oriented which involves responding to requests for information and communicating with the public. Knowledgeable problem solvers are needed to perform a variety of functions which may include resolving property management issues, addressing delinquent payments by providing resolutions and guidance to tenants. Candidates must possess strong communication skills to accurately and effectively communicate with other departments, consultants, contractors and other internal and external stakeholders.

Essential Functions

Processes routine temporary revocable easements, rights of entry and real estate service requests under general supervision. 

Performs the basic components of professional level acquisition, disposition, and property management.

Prepares basic legal forms and transactional documents within established procedures.

Tracks project status.  Prepares Reports. Updates and maintains GIS databases.

Communicates accurately and effectively with City Consultants, Contractors, City Departments, and various internal and external stakeholders.

Utilizes appraisal reports, legal descriptions, subdivision plats and engineering plans, ensuring accuracy and compliance with operating procedures.

Responds to requests for information and explains procedure to the Public. 

Performs basic to semi complex research as necessary. Supports higher level classifications including data entry and file management.

Assists with the necessary data gathering and background information for public meeting communications. 

Attends public meetings upon request.

Minimum Qualifications

Minimum Education Level & Type: Associate's Degree

Minimum Experience Qualifications: At least 2 years in real estate transactions involving appraisal, title examination, purchase, sale, exchange and lease of property, and right of way

An equivalent combination of education, training and experience which provides the required knowledge, skills and abilities to perform the essential functions of this position may be considered.
